Steve Matthiasson is probably one of the most sought after vineyard managers in the Napa Valley. His current clients include Araujo Estate, Spottswoode, Chappellet, Hall, David Arthur, Stag’s Leap Wine Cellars, and many others.

Steve dreamt of farming his entire life. He became an obsessed gardener and cook while studying philosophy in college. In the early 1990s, while back in grad school studying  horticulture he found a vineyard job working for a small sustainable agriculture consulting firm. In 1999 he co-authored the California manual on sustainable vineyard practices. In 2002 he started consulting on vineyard practices in Napa. He still loves the challenge of solving vineyard problems for others, but since 2003 the primary focus has been on his own family farming and winemaking. Steve is a life-long student of the craft of viticulture. Steve  Matthiasson was named “Winemaker of the Year” in 2014, and that is an honor not given to everyone!  Steve meticulously farms his own vineyard at night and even on Sundays!  One of the nicest guys in the Valley, a quiet “rock star” of sort.  He is not noticed, but the wineries noticed him!

The 2013 Matthiasson White Blend consists out of 55% Sauvignon Blanc, 25% Ribolla Gialla, 15% Semillon & 5% Tocai Friulano. The Sauvignon blanc brings a clean fresh citrusy acidity and some tropical character. The Ribolla gialla brings seashell minerality, nuttiness, and structure to the blend. The Semillon contributes viscosity and waxiness that adds gravity and weight. The Tocai friulano adds spicy aromatic notes. The acidity and fruit expression is balanced by a rich lees character and a faint backdrop of creamy oak. Mark Herold’s fascination with wine started in his childhood home in Panama City. On his twelfth birthday he “liberated” a bottle of Port from his father’s cellar. Undeterred from the horrendous hangover that followed the next morning, he set about to learn as much as he could about wine. After completing his academic career at the University of Davis with a Ph.D. in Ecology with an emphasis in nutritional biochemistry, he started his first foray into the wine world at Joseph Phelps Vineyards as the Research Enologist. Here Mark was able to bridge the scientific method with winemaking to determine the best approach to making the best expression of wine quality and seamless oak integration.

Merus was a labor of love that Mark started in 1998—a Cult Cabernet Sauvignon that he made in his garage in downtown Napa. His first vintage was extremely challenging weather wise as well as having limited access to equipment. Aside from all the challenges the 1998 Merus still received 93 points from Robert Parker. Most wineries received low 80s for the 98 vintage! Merus “died” after Mark’s divorce, and he started his wine consulting business soon after with a client list that has includes: Hestan, Kamen (96 Points 2012 vintage), Harris, Buccella, Kobalt (96 Points 2012 vintage), Celani, Maze (95 Points 2012 vintage) & Vineyardist (96 Points 2012 vintage).

In the early 1930’s Garret Bowlus’ grandfather William Hawley Bowlus began launching his one of a kind “Albatross” sailplanes off the ridges of Carmel Valley. Today his family carries on his avant-garde legacy farming Pinot Noir and Chardonnay on a steep Carmel Valley ridge rising over 1250 feet. The vines are rooted in a rocky diatomaceous clay loam soil overlooking Carmel Bay and the Pacific Ocean only seven miles in the distance. They handcraft the wines from soil to bottle with the utmost care and consideration to unearth the unique terroir and reveal the elegance and complexity of the distinct coastal location.
